1. 变量与常量 2. 空安全(必考!) 3. 集合类型 4. 函数(重要!) 5. 面向对象 6. 异步编程(重点!) 三、Flutter特有...
一、单线程+事件循环机制 1. 核心原理 2. 面试回答要点 问:Dart是单线程的,为什么能处理异步? 答:Dart虽然是单线程,但通过"事件...
1. 数组与字符串:滑动窗口 题目描述:给定一个字符串 s,请你找出其中不含有重复字符的 最长子串 的长度。 示例 1: 示例 2: JavaS...
一、 布局核心:约束传递模型 所有布局都遵循这个流程: 父级向子级传递约束:父 Widget 告诉子 Widget:“你的宽度必须在 minWi...
React Native核心特性详解(面试重点) 一、核心架构原理 1. 三层架构模型 2. 新架构(Fabric + TurboModules...
在React Native应用中,RN的加载和初始化过程,以及相关核心类的理解确实很重要。为了帮助你快速梳理,下面这个表格汇总了Native层(...
一、ArkTS 语言基础(重中之重) ArkTS 是鸿蒙应用的官方主力开发语言,它是 TypeScript 的超集。 1. ArkTS 的起源与...
AbortController 是一个现代浏览器和Node.js提供的Web API,用于中止一个或多个Web请求。它不仅能用于取消fetch请...
一、RN引擎的核心构成 React Native 的"引擎"主要包含两个核心部分: 引擎组件职责类比JavaScript 引擎执行你的JS代码、...